Transaction 08e05dcf819d537cefa541d3d3731c5817729ee07c48819717642dece3648aae

25 Input
2 Outputs
  • 08e05dcf819d537cefa541d3d3731c5817729ee07c48819717642dece3648aae:0
  • value  29326
    address  18Lumqk3NLb1XCAVhdwEwtijribL6UqBuk
  • 08e05dcf819d537cefa541d3d3731c5817729ee07c48819717642dece3648aae:1
  • value  33906300
    address  3MY3CCuxTdzivejjfTyUg8W5AWAzC5zGZ7